Statement of Purpose

Currents in Electronic Literacy strives to promote, interrogate, and critique the discourse of electronic literacy by reviewing and assessing the present state of the field. We define electronic literacy widely: literature, rhetoric and composition, languages (English, foreign, and ESL), communications, media studies, education, and pedagogy. Currents publishes scholarly articles, interviews, and review articles (including reviews of: books, websites, software, and new media).
